#d678d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d678d4 is composed of 83.9% red, 47.1%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.9% magenta, 0.9%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 301.3 degrees, a saturation of 53.4% and a lightness of 65.5%. #d678d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ff0ff with #ad00a9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

● #d678d4 color description : Slightly desaturated magenta.
#d678d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d678d4 has RGB values of R:214, G:120,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.01,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14055636.
